Retrocycle sells a full line of quality Motorcycle covers for Harleys and Metric bikes.  Our Dowco covers offer protection from dust and from rain and the elements.  Even indoors its a good idea to cover your motorcycle to keep dust and dirt off the paint.  Dust is an abrasive and can dull the finish of your bike.

Metal Finishing – Cad Plating, Polishing and Parkerizing

December 27th, 2009 Post a Comment »

Retrocycle Metal Finishing Services

Cadmium, Zinc, Nickel, Electroless Nickel, Copper, Parkerizing, Black Oxide, Aluminum Polishing and much more!

Did you know that some of the top restoration experts in the Antique Motorcycle Club of America (AMCA) use Retrocycle for their metal finishing?

I hear from a lot of my customers about finding a source of cad plating and parkerizing.

When I inform them that Retrocycle offers this service there are several questions that I’m asked almost without fail.

1. Is it real or is it copy cad?

Our cad plating service is performed by a government certified plating service that services mostly to military specifications.  This is the “real deal” and is actual cadmium plating (not a kit).

2. What is the turn around time?

In most cases we can turn your metal finishing order around within a week of receipt.  What this means is that we can generally have the order ready to send back to you within 7 business days from when we actually receive it at our shop.  Of course, sometimes it will take a bit longer but we pride ourselves on the quality of service and the quick turnaround that we offer.

3.  What do I have to do to prepare my order?

Generally, we like the products to be degreased but we offer media blasting as part of the service so there is no need to go crazy with the preparation.   Mostly, what we ask, is that all parts are completely disassembled.  This means that locknuts and washers must be seperated from brake rods or other component units.  If we have to extend labor to disassemble items we have to charge for this.

We also ask that you send duplicates of smaller items when possible.  For example, if you are sending a spoke set with nipples, it is a good idea to send an extra (or two) due to the off chance a small item gets lost in the process.  This has not happened to us in the past but it is an occurrence that does happen in the metal finishing industry.

4.   COST?   What will this cost me?

Cost is determined by the lot size.   Our minimum charge is $75.00.   The best approach is to e-mail or call us.  We can then direct you to either bring the parts to our shop or e-mail us pictures.  We can then quote you a price based on size of the lot to be finished.

Blacked out Panhead Replica Engines by Vulcan

December 14th, 2009 Post a Comment »

These engines are just fantastic! The craftsmanship and

care taken in the assembly is hard to find these days.

Get that Panhead look in a modern, hydraulic lifter,

Evo-type engine.

Buy the engine here

vulcan_panhead_blacked_out_5

Cylinders
Cast From Closed Grain Nodular Iron
3-5/8” Big Bore
Extra Thick Base Flange
High Crown Heat Treated Base Nuts
Keith Black 8.5:1 CR Pistons (80 CC Dome )
Hastings Ring Pack
Seal Methods Head & Base Gaskets
High Gloss Black Powder Coated Cylinders
5.330” Cylinder Length
Cylinder Heads

S.T.D. High Performance
Shovel Head Style Port Layout
Ported Intake & Exhaust Ports
3 Angle Serdi Valve Seats
Manley Valve Guides, Honed To Size
320 CFM Intake Port
250 CFM Exhaust Port
108 cc Combustion Chamber
Dual Spark Plugs
Cam Chest

Vulcanworks Billet Cam Cover
Vulcanworks Breather Baffle
Jims Machine Pinion Gear
Vulcanworks Distributor Drive Gear
Vulcanworks Dist. Gear Shaft
Vulcanworks Steel Breather Gear
Seal Methods Cave Cover Gasket

Accessories
Billet Oil Filter Adapter
Rev Tech Oil Filter
Stainless Steel Braided Rocker Feed Oil lines
Billet Aluminum Oil Line/Oil Gage Adapter
Oil Pressure Gage

Valve Train
Vulcanworks EVO Style Hydraulic Lifters
Vulcanworks Billet Aluminum Tappet Blocks
Vulcanworks Chromemoly Pushrods
Colony Pushrod Tubes
Andrews Special Grind Camshaft, .485 Lift
OEM Style Rocker Arms, Blueprinted
Vulcanworks Billet Aluminium Valve Covers
Grade ‘8’, 12 Point Rocker Arm Block Bolts
Manley 2.00” Hard Chromed Intake Valves
Manley 1.750” Hard Chromed Exhaust Valves
Manley Double Wound Valve Springs
Manley Heat Treated Valve Keepers
N.O.K. Viton Valve Seals

Ignition
Vulcanworks Billet Aluminum Distributor
Heat Treated Auto Advance
Single Or Dual Fire
Uses 3 or 5 Ohm Coils
2. Champion Spark Plugs # RN14Y

Oil Pump
Vulcanworks, Billet aluminum, 1981-1991 Style
Vulcanworks Oil Pump Drive Gear
1973- Drive Ratio

Fuel System
S&S Super ‘E’
Band Style Intake
S&S Air Cleaner Assembly
Also Included Is a Vulcanworks Billet Velocity Stack / With Air Diverter
